    I'm looking for a source for body panels for a e3 69' 2500. primarily I am looking for front fenders. I have tried junk/salvage yards with few results. Any help would be greatly appreciated.

    You might try hitting up these guys (http://seniorsix.org/) or emailing Rob Siegel (the Hack Mechanic) or asking Carl Nelson @ La Jolla Independent, or maybe here: http://www.thewerkshop.com/ Another idea - search google.de . You can put the url in google translate (https://translate.google.com/) specifying from German to English, the translation isn't 100% but it's better than nothing & you get enough to get an idea what it says. Even so, given the age & rarity, I'd be surprised if you found much for E9's on ebay for Germany.
